How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Brandywyne?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Brandywyne Studio Apartments | $1,262 | $1,000 | $1,423 |
| Brandywyne 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,448 | $900 | $1,775 |
| Brandywyne 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,722 | $993 | $3,250 |
| Brandywyne 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,906 | $1,144 | $3,192 |
| Brandywyne 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,938 | $2,050 | $4,566 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Brandywyne
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Brandywyne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Brandywyne ranges from $900 to $1,775 with an average monthly rent of $1,448.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Brandywyne c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Brandywyne range from $993 to $3,250.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,722.
How expensive are Brandywyne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 16 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Brandywyne on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,144 to $3,192 - averaging $1,906 for the location.
